Day: 1-2 Las Vegas & Grand Canyon
First up, the daddy of all canyons. Staying two nights is an open invite to explore some of those cliff-top walking trails and monumental observation spots. Enjoy a beautiful sunrise and an unforgettable helicopter flight over this incredible natural wonder. You are sure to be left with feelings of awe and amazement.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 3 Monument Valley
Get that red dust beneath your boots and pitch camp under a million blazing stars. Monument Valley has been used in Hollywood scenes from Westerns to 2001: A Space Odyssey and everything in between. Be amazed as our Navajo guide takes us deep into the sacred valley on our included jeep tour under azure Arizona sky. Tonight, experience a stunning sunset over the mesa and buttes.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 4 Wild West Cowboy Camp
It's time for our Wild West Cowboy Camp. Yee-ha! If you packed a ten-gallon hat, tonight's the night to wear it. After an exciting horseride though the desert, tuck into your delicious cowboy feast before a great night under the western stars.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 5 Canyonlands
It couldn't sound more like cowboy country if it tried. It's dressed for the part too, with its flat-topped mesas streaked in burnt oranges, amber and deep red... perfect for hiking! We immerse ourselves with magnificent views of Canyonlands and take in the breathtaking vistas that surround us. This is one of America's least known, but most spectacular National Parks!
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 6/7 Arches National Park
The park's name says it all. Some 2,000 orange sandstone arches strike their poses. Saddle up and set off on your mountain bike along the Slickrock Trail. Weird and wonderful rock formations add surreal decoration to exciting bike routes and challenging hiking circuits are perfect for the HUMMER tour! The scenery here is breathtaking and a sunset stroll to Delicate Arch tops most 'to do' lists.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 8 Bryce Canyon National Park
It's Wall Street, but not as you know it. Follow this narrow passage through sheer rock face and pop up in the Silent City, an astounding gathering of those trademark hoodoos, makes for a beautiful walk. What's a hoodoo when it's at home? Actually, Hoodoos are weird and wonderful rock spires arranged in rows as far as the eye can see. They will leave you searching for your own way to describe this 'indescribable' place.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 9 Zion National Park
All canyoned out yet? Not a bit of it! So go with the flow - the flow of the Virgin River, that is, as it cuts a snaking path between tinted cliff walls. Or hike to the famed Angel's Landing for an amazing birds-eye view. Okay, so getting up there can be devilish at times, but the trail puts Zion on a 360-degree display of this magnificent national park.
Accommodation: Camping included
-
Day: 10 Las Vegas
How about one last cowboy encounter, Sin City-style? Say hi to Vegas Vic and Vegas Vicky, the neon twosome who beat all those other Vegas signs hands down. We'll tour the city and then the night is yours to explore the clubs and casinos.
Tour ends at approx 17:00 hours on day 10 in Las Vegas.
